#686970 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#686970 is composed of 40.8% red, 41.2%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.1% cyan, 6.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 232.5 degrees, a saturation of 3.7% and a lightness of 42.4%. #686970 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0d2e0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#686970 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#686970 has RGB values of R:104, G:105,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 6842736.

Shades and Tints of #686970
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f5f5f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#686970
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686970 is the less saturated color, while #041ed4 is the most saturated one.
